#a448a0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a448a0 is composed of 64.3% red, 28.2% green and 62.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.1% magenta, 2.4%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 302.6 degrees, a saturation of 39% and a lightness of 46.3%. #a448a0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ff90ff with #490041.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#a448a0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f9f2f9 is the lightest one.
